Police figures show: Crime has been fought more in years past this year

Prime Minister Albin Kurti is continuing statements that since his coming to the helm of the government has begun fighting organised crime. Even on October 14th, Prime Minister Kurti, from Skopje, had said that they were struggling hard against crime and criminal groups. However, figures show that even when Kurti was not in power, Kosovo Police (PK) had fought criminal groups and carried out even bigger shares showing even greater successes in the last two years than this year.
Based on police statistics, 34 criminal groups were hit this year, a year earlier 28, until 37 criminal groups were hit in 2019, reports “Justice Trust”.
Thus, the fight against criminal groups has not increased greatly since Prime Minister Kurti's arrival at the head of government.
The success of the Kosovo Police has been greater in sequencing heroin in the years 2019 and 2020 than this year. Two years ago, nearly 50 pounds [8 kg] of heroin were seized last year, up to nine pounds [9.8 kg] until this year alone.
In cocaine sequencing, the year 2021 is more successful for the Kosovo Police, having seized 412 kilos, while a year ago only 2.6 kg and in 2019 only 1.5 kg.
Even in marijuana sequencing, 2019 has been more successful compared to 2020 and 2021. Two years ago, 184 pounds [824 kg] have been seized, last year 256 pounds [256 kg], and this year only 215 pounds [291 kg] have been seized.
Even in the selection of cannabis plants, 2019 was more successful for the Kosovo Police than in 2020 and 2021. Cannabis plants in 2019 have been seized 6 thousand and 810, until a year later 5 thousand and 622. This year, however, only 1,000 and 470 cannabis plants have been seized.
Even in weapons sequencing, 2019 leads to police results. Two years ago, 212 weapons were seized, last year 98, until only 58 weapons were seized this year.
In the balance of money, Kosovo police this year have shown more success than in the two years ahead. So this year it has seized 3.8m euros, last year over half a million, until it was seized in 2019.
Kosovo police have mostly confiscated francs this year, compared to the two previous years.
This year it seized 5.8 million francs, last year 4.2 million, until in 2019 only 1.2 million francs.
